## Postmortem: Stale Cache in Bramblewick Signing

Quick recap for the security review. The Bramblewick signer cached verification material for 24h, but the rotation job on Thornvale only invalidated the primary node. Replicas kept serving the old key, so artifacts signed after Tuesday's rotation failed verification downstream. Fun times. Fix: cache TTL dropped to 5 minutes, plus an explicit purge hook on rotation. No evidence of tampering — just staleness. For audit purposes, the currently active signing key is recorded below.

release key, fahaf-bajof: bky3_Xam

## Orders Table: Soft Deletes

For support: cancelled orders in the Thornquill system are never hard-deleted. The `orders` table sets `deleted_at` instead, so a "missing" order is usually just filtered out. Always include soft-deleted rows when investigating customer reports. To query the read replica directly, use the connection string provided below.

replica DSN, kajep-yahag: mssql://praok_svc:iF@db-8d68.plorvaio.local:5432/eliion

The Tillbridge gateway bridges handheld barcode scanners in the Orchard Row warehouses to the inventory service. There are three environments: dev uses simulated scan traffic, staging talks to a single test lane, and production serves all lanes. On-call note: scanner firmware negotiates its protocol version at connect time, so a gateway restart forces every device to re-pair, which takes about two minutes per lane. Restart during shift change if possible. Each environment applies the configuration values shown below.

deployment values, yadug-bawif:
[framir]
team = pelox
access_code = ac_a38ab2
owner = tamion.julael
host = framir.tolvaqlabs.test
port = 11211
peer = tammir.zemvargrid.local
salt = 2215ef03
pin = 1541